Design de Interfaces e Usabilidade

0

   

Design de Interfaces e Usabilidade

O Design de Interfaces e Usabilidade é um campo essencial no desenvolvimento de sistemas interativos, com foco em criar interfaces que sejam esteticamente agradáveis, intuitivas e eficientes para os usuários. Ele combina elementos de design visual, psicologia cognitiva, experiência do usuário (UX) e acessibilidade para oferecer soluções que otimizem a interação entre humanos e sistemas computacionais.


1. O que é Design de Interfaces?

O Design de Interfaces (ou UI Design, User Interface Design) refere-se à criação dos elementos visuais e interativos de um sistema, como botões, menus, formulários, ícones e layouts. Ele se preocupa com:

  • Aparência visual: Escolha de cores, tipografia, espaçamento e alinhamento.
  • Interatividade: Feedback ao usuário por meio de animações, mudanças de estado e respostas a interações.
  • Estrutura lógica: Organização de elementos que facilite a navegação.

1.1. Objetivos do Design de Interfaces

  • Criar uma interface agradável e atraente.
  • Facilitar a navegação e o acesso às funcionalidades.
  • Garantir consistência e familiaridade para evitar confusão.
  • Fornecer feedback imediato e relevante para as ações do usuário.

2. O que é Usabilidade?

A Usabilidade mede a eficácia, eficiência e satisfação com que os usuários conseguem alcançar seus objetivos em um sistema. Um produto com boa usabilidade deve:

  • Ser fácil de aprender e lembrar.
  • Permitir que o usuário complete tarefas com rapidez e sem erros.
  • Oferecer uma experiência satisfatória e sem frustrações.

2.1. Princípios de Usabilidade

  1. Facilidade de Aprendizado: Usuários devem compreender rapidamente como usar o sistema na primeira interação.
  2. Eficiência: O design deve permitir que tarefas sejam realizadas de maneira rápida e sem esforço.
  3. Prevenção de Erros: O sistema deve minimizar a possibilidade de erros e oferecer maneiras de corrigi-los facilmente.
  4. Consistência: Elementos semelhantes devem funcionar da mesma forma em todo o sistema.
  5. Feedback: Informar os usuários sobre o status de suas ações, como carregar dados ou finalizar uma transação.

3. Diferença entre UI e UX

Embora frequentemente usados juntos, UI (User Interface) e UX (User Experience) são conceitos distintos:

  • UI: Foca no aspecto visual e interativo do design (cores, tipografia, layout, botões, etc.).
  • UX: Lida com a experiência total do usuário, incluindo usabilidade, funcionalidade e emoção.

Exemplo: Em um aplicativo de e-commerce:

  • A UI determina o design do botão “Adicionar ao Carrinho”.
  • A UX considera como o usuário se sente ao encontrar, adicionar e comprar produtos.

4. Elementos do Design de Interfaces

4.1. Layout

  • Organização dos elementos em uma interface para facilitar a navegação e a clareza.
  • Exemplo: Páginas com hierarquias claras e áreas bem definidas, como cabeçalhos, rodapés e menus laterais.

4.2. Cores

  • Uso estratégico de cores para transmitir informações e criar uma identidade visual.
  • Exemplo: Vermelho para alertas, verde para confirmações, azul para botões de ação.

4.3. Tipografia

  • Escolha de fontes legíveis e adequadas ao propósito do sistema.
  • Exemplo: Fontes simples para textos longos e fontes destacadas para títulos.

4.4. Ícones e Botões

  • Ícones ajudam a economizar espaço e facilitar a identificação de ações.
  • Botões devem ter feedback visual (ex.: mudar de cor quando clicados).

4.5. Feedback ao Usuário

  • Informações claras sobre o estado do sistema.
  • Exemplo: Indicadores de carregamento, mensagens de erro ou de sucesso.

4.6. Navegação

  • Estruturas simples e consistentes para ajudar os usuários a encontrar informações.
  • Exemplo: Barras de menus, breadcrumbs (trilhas de navegação) e pesquisa interna.

5. Processos no Design de Interfaces e Usabilidade

5.1. Pesquisa com Usuários

  • Entender as necessidades, expectativas e dificuldades dos usuários.
  • Técnicas comuns:
    • Entrevistas e grupos focais.
    • Questionários e observações.

5.2. Prototipagem

  • Protótipos em papel: Esboços rápidos para testar ideias iniciais.
  • Wireframes: Estruturas visuais que mostram a hierarquia e organização da interface.
  • Protótipos interativos: Modelos que simulam a interação do usuário com o sistema.

5.3. Testes de Usabilidade

  • Testes conduzidos com usuários reais para identificar problemas de interação.
  • Exemplo: Pedir que usuários concluam tarefas específicas enquanto observadores registram dificuldades.

5.4. Iteração

  • Refinamento contínuo baseado no feedback dos usuários e resultados de testes.

6. Ferramentas para Design de Interfaces e Usabilidade

  • Figma: Ferramenta colaborativa para criação de designs e protótipos.
  • Adobe XD: Plataforma para design de interfaces e prototipagem.
  • Sketch: Ferramenta popular para UI/UX design.
  • InVision: Focada em prototipagem e colaboração em equipe.
  • Hotjar: Para análise de comportamento do usuário (mapas de calor, gravações de sessão).

7. Boas Práticas no Design de Interfaces e Usabilidade

  1. Design Responsivo: As interfaces devem se adaptar a diferentes dispositivos e tamanhos de tela.
  2. Minimizar a Sobrecarga Cognitiva: Evitar interfaces muito complexas ou sobrecarregadas de informações.
  3. Consistência: Usar padrões visuais e interativos consistentes em todo o sistema.
  4. Priorizar o Usuário: Sempre projetar pensando no público-alvo e em suas necessidades.
  5. Acessibilidade: Garantir que pessoas com deficiências possam usar o sistema (ex.: suporte para leitores de tela).
  6. Testar e Ajustar: Realizar testes contínuos para identificar problemas e melhorar a usabilidade.

8. Exemplos de Interfaces Bem-Sucedidas

8.1. Google

  • Interface minimalista e limpa.
  • Foco na funcionalidade principal: busca.

8.2. Airbnb

  • Design visualmente atraente e intuitivo.
  • Navegação fácil com filtros bem estruturados.

8.3. Spotify

  • Interface amigável e adaptada para navegação em desktop e mobile.
  • Organização lógica de menus e playlists.

9. Desafios e Tendências em Design de Interfaces e Usabilidade

9.1. Desafios

  • Adaptação a novas tecnologias, como interfaces baseadas em voz (ex.: Alexa, Siri).
  • Garantir privacidade e segurança ao projetar interfaces.
  • Tornar interfaces intuitivas para usuários de diferentes níveis de habilidade técnica.

9.2. Tendências

  • Design Minimalista: Interfaces simples e funcionais.
  • Interfaces Conversacionais: Assistentes virtuais e chatbots.
  • Dark Mode: Oferecer opções de temas escuros para conforto visual.
  • Microinterações: Pequenas animações que tornam as interações mais envolventes (ex.: curtidas em redes sociais).

Conclusão

O Design de Interfaces e Usabilidade desempenha um papel crucial em garantir que sistemas sejam funcionais e agradáveis para os usuários. Combinando pesquisa, criatividade e iteração, os profissionais dessa área criam soluções que não apenas atendem às necessidades dos usuários, mas também os surpreendem positivamente. Com a evolução contínua da tecnologia, o design centrado no usuário permanece como um dos pilares para o sucesso de produtos digitais.

Postar um comentário

0 Comentários
* Please Don't Spam Here. All the Comments are Reviewed by Admin.